Compressor Type

Scroll compressors are more efficient and quieter than reciprocating types, but cost more. Variable-speed compressors are the premium option for maximum efficiency.

Refrigerant Type And Charge

R-22 systems require an expensive refrigerant or full system upgrade. R-410A is standard and more affordable. Proper charge quantity affects both cost and performance.

📏
Warranty Status

If your compressor is under manufacturer warranty, you may only pay labor ($500–$1,000). Out-of-warranty compressors include the full part cost ($1,000–$2,500).

🔧
System Age

For systems over 10 years old, replacing just the compressor may not be cost-effective — a full system replacement offers better long-term value.

🏗️
Matching Indoor Components

Mismatched indoor/outdoor components reduce efficiency by 10–30%. Your technician should verify compatibility before replacing only the compressor.

Should I replace just the AC compressor or the whole system?

If your system is under 8 years old and the compressor is the only issue, replacing just the compressor makes sense. If the system is 10+ years old, a full replacement gives you a warranty on all components, better efficiency, and avoids the risk of other parts failing soon.

What causes an AC compressor to fail?

Common causes include refrigerant leaks (the #1 cause), electrical problems, dirty condenser coils reducing airflow, and contaminants in the refrigerant lines. Annual professional maintenance ($100–$200) catches these issues early and extends compressor life significantly.
